#ProPlantTips for Care:

Follow these simple care requirements for a long-lived, happy Easy on the Eyes™ Rose. Roses grow best when planted in full sun, where they receive at least six hours of sun a day. The morning sun is great because it quickly dries off the foliage. Good airflow is important to keep your Rose healthy. Likewise, enriched soil and well-drained locations are a must.

Apply a consistent amount of water on a regular basis. Use mulch to help keep the roots moist, and avoid splashing water onto the foliage..but please pull it back from directly touching the stems. Feed your Roses a good slow-release fertilizer according to the directions. Reapply this flowering plant food until July.

In early spring as the plants begin to wake up, put on your thick gloves and sharpen your garden shears. Prune all stems down to six inches from the ground and watch for the glorious new foliage to appear. Rose Bush FAQs

Where Is The Best Place To Plant Rose Bushes?

Roses need full sun and favor the drying power of the morning sun, flowering best in at least 6 hours of direct sunlight a day. Choose a location in good, enriched soil that drains well and has good air circulation.

What Is The Best Month to Plant Roses?

You can plant Roses any time if you are able to provide enough consistent moisture and attention. While there is not a specific month that is best, generally because it changes with temperatures, climate and growing zone. However, the easiest times of the year to get Rose bushes established in your landscape are in spring after the last frost date, and in fall about 4-6 weeks before the first frost.

Do Roses Come Back Every Year?

Rose bushes are deciduous woody perennial shrubs and will return bigger and better each year.
